USA: Council OKs Sterne Lake Dredging Funds

The Littleton City Council and the South Suburban Parks and Recreation Board of Directors will split the cost of a project to dredge Sterne Lake, 5800 South Spotswood Street, later this year.

The proposed work will also include some related bank stabilization, re-grading and re-vegetation, all of which should help improve water quality in the lake.

A number of factors may affect the cost, primarily disposal of the removed sediment. The lake has not been dredged since the mid-1990s.

Over the years, accumulated sludge and sediment in the lake have significantly lowered the water level. In some places, the lake is less than three feet deep. The maintenance of the lake is very important to the neighborhood, to Sterne Park visitors, and the park’s aquatic habitat.
